Queuetide autoscaler: scales workers off broker queue depth, sampled every 15s. Thresholds live in scaler.yaml; do not hardcode. If scaling stalls, check the decision log first — 90% of incidents are stale metrics from the Brimford metrics relay. Restarting the relay pod clears it. Manual scale overrides require authenticating against the internal control API using the key below.

API key for yahig-tadup: kto7_ubizbYm

## TICK-1187: Chip reader uploading to wrong event

The Fleetline chip reader at the Brackenford Marathon finish mat was flashed with last season's env file, so splits posted to the archived event and runners saw no live times. Support: do not ask crews to re-scan; data is intact on-device. Fix is to push the current `.env` with `EVENT_ID=brackenford-2025` and `UPLOAD_INTERVAL_SEC=5`, then reboot the reader. The corrected file must also include the reader's upload credential on the line that follows.

secret setting of hawep-yahig: LEDGER_TOKEN29=41b5d6315371c92885eaeb077fb63

Welcome to the LiftLogic team. Our elevator-dispatch simulator, CabRoute, models car assignment, door-dwell timing, and peak-traffic scenarios for the Fenwick Tower pilot. As support staff, you'll mostly field questions about scenario files failing validation — nine times out of ten the floor-count field doesn't match the shaft definition. Always ask customers for the scenario export before escalating, and never edit their files directly; clone them into a sandbox run instead. Step-by-step triage instructions live on the internal page below.

dashboard of fajop-badug = https://jira.qorvelsys.internal/pages/pages/pages/display